Lament of the heavy lover

I saw her on Facebook, sent her a friend’s request

She added me, and then we also met on Twitter

For sometime it seemed that we’d remain unmet

For she had Gchat, I felt Yahoo was much better

 

Once where a poke or a LOL would suffice

She wanted us to meet, it caught me by surprise

I am fat and balding, my profile pic was photoshopped

She was comely, and witty, I felt my stomach drop

 

Reluctantly after a few weeks I have had to agree

My love story I think is coming to an end

We meet today, This is my poetic lament

For who would love a man so bald and chunky

===========================================================

The girl’s reply

Do not think that I am dumb or entirely lacking wit

As soon as you said you worked on the internet

I knew you were shy,  had glasses and were fat

I had to break the ice, make moves, its a fact

 

I want a man with whom I can be comfortable and free

Not another male hunk who ogles at girls who are chesty

You techys will drool over gizmos and talk greek

And wont fuss if dinner is simple sandwich and coffee

 

If you like we can talk on chat box the whole day long

You wont know if I havent dusted or the curtain’s torn

You will drool over browsers, talk in HTML code

Why, you may even someday type me an ode

 

You never even noticed that my skin was pimply

That I am dark, plain and am quite skinny

I have met other men who are quite fussy

You dont know yet, I think it is you who I will marry

 

Its gonna be a great thing you just dont know that yet

Besides computer geeks earn a lot of money on the internet
